Introduction: The spinal cord is a continuation from the medulla oblongata of the brain stem. It allows communication between the brain and the rest of the body. The spinal nerves contain both sensory and motor fibers. We will see that multiple spinal cord levels can contribute to the formation of a peripheral nerve as fibers pass through the various plexuses. The protective role of a reflex arc will be examined. Describe a reflex arc including the 5 components. (5 points) A reflex arc is the most basic pathway in the nervous system. There are 5 components. Sensory receptor is a reflex that begins when sensory receptors are activated in response to a particular stimulus. Sensory neuron fires an action potential along a sensory neuron that travels with the dorsal root of a spinal nerve into the spinal cord. Synapses and interneurons are the sensory neuron that synapse directly with a motor neuron or interneurons .Motor neuron initiates an action potential which is then propagated along a motor neuron, in the ventral root of a spinal nerve to an effector, such as a skeletal muscle. Effector responds with a reflex action, such as contraction. 5. Describe the reflex response to a painful stimulus such as stepping on a nail. (2 points) An extensor reflex is begins by painful stimulus and happens at the same time as the flexor reflex. the Reflex contraction of the extensor muscles of the unharmed limb, allows the body to balance while the flexor reflex takes the harmed limb away from the stimulus. 6.
